Runsewe To Youths: Bobrisky Not A Cultural Ambassador

 
 

The Director-General of the National Council for Arts and Culture has lambasted the controversial Nigerian Internet personality and cross dresser, Okuneye Idris Olarenwaju aka Bobrisky.
Otunba Segun Runsewe insisted that Bobrisky, whose contentious gender and amorously weird dress sense halts the true Nigerian culture which is respected and admired all over the world.

Runsewe spoke at an event marking the World Handcrafts Day at the NCAC headquarters in Abuja observed with dismay the bastardisation of our noble culture and values by attention-seeking characters such as Bobrisky who he described as a very bad example that the youths should not emulate.
The NCAC boss lamented especially the use of social media by Bobrisky and his ilk to continually send very bad signals to the world in what he called a totally false representation of our identity noting that this must be put in check.
